Cryptography supplies for secure communication within the presence of malicious third-parties—known as adversaries. Encryption makes use of an algorithm and a key to remodel an enter (i.e., plaintext) into an encrypted output (i.e., ciphertext). A given algorithm will always rework the identical plaintext into the identical ciphertext if the same key is used. Algorithms are thought-about secure if an attacker cannot determine any properties of the plaintext or key, given the ciphertext. One example of symmetric-key cryptography is the Advanced Encryption Normal (AES). AES is a specification established in November 2001 by the National Institute of Requirements and Technology (NIST) as a Federal Information Processing Standard (FIPS 197) to guard delicate info. The commonplace is remitted by the us authorities and widely used in the private sector. NIST announced it’s going to have three quantum-resistant cryptographic algorithms prepared to be used in 2024.

Cryptography is a necessary type of cybersecurity that uses encryption methods to keep digital knowledge and communications secure and out of the arms of potential threats or dangerous actors. Data protection is extremely necessary in this digital era the place so much information is saved on computers, within the cloud, and on the web. Information safety is necessary to businesses, industries, corporations, and individuals alike. Cryptography is a type of securing digital data and messages usually utilizing special keys that only the sender and recipient have access to. Cryptography uses mathematical systems and algorithms to encrypt and decrypt data.
